Summary

Charlie discusses the ongoing legal challenges in Georgia including the explosive testimony from Thursday's hearings that continue to ripple across the conservative media sphere. And then Charlie turns his attention to the epidemic of weak Republican politicians who have continued to avoid the election fraud fight, and why the pressure that movement conservatives put on these elected officials can make all the difference not only in Georgia, but even the presidency.
